  1. ““Under West Virginia Constitution, Article VIII, section 24, and Code 1931, 7-1-3, county courts are vested with primary jurisdiction to settle accounts of personal representatives, but such jurisdiction may be interrupted by equity where there is involved some question of equitable cognizance as, for example, the construction of a will, fraud, waste, and the like.””
